GASTON NOURY (1866-?) POUR LES PAUVRES. 1892.
53 1/2x35 1/2 inches. Herold, Paris.
Condition B+: repaired tears in margins; restoration and restored losses along vertical and horizontal folds.
Born in Le Havre, Normandy, Noury was an illustrator who settled in Paris around 1889. With only a few posters to his name it seems he was closely connected to the affichomanie of the period. He designed posters for two of the active poster dealers, Arnould and le pere Didier, and for the 3rd exposition of the Salon des Cent at La Plume. Here, for a charity event at the Tuileries to raise money for the poor in both France and Russia, Noury shows a French woman and Russian woman in a sleigh. With the pending signing of the Franco-Russian alliance, this kind of event would have been extremely au courant. Maitres pl. 39, Gold p. 124.
